Preparing dough in a professional bakery requires precision and uniformity. Whether for pastries, pizza bases, croissants, or flatbreads, the thickness and consistency of dough influence both texture and final presentation. These dough sheeter machines allow bakers to roll dough evenly without repeated manual effort. In bakeries, pastry kitchens, and food production units, this equipment helps maintain consistent dough thickness while improving preparation speed during busy production cycles.
Many bakeries rely on a commercial dough sheeter to manage large batches of dough while maintaining uniform results across multiple preparations. FAQs
1. What causes dough sticking during sheeting and how can it be avoided?
Improper flouring or overly warm dough can cause sticking, so maintaining correct temperature and light dusting is essential.
2. Why do bakeries use a commercial dough sheeter?
A commercial dough sheeter allows bakeries to roll large batches of dough quickly while maintaining consistent thickness across every sheet.
3. What types of dough can be processed using a dough sheeter machine?
A dough sheeter machine can handle pastry dough, pizza dough, puff pastry, croissant dough, and other bakery preparations.
4. Is a dough sheeter suitable for small bakeries?
Yes, many small bakeries use a commercial dough sheeter to improve efficiency and maintain consistent dough preparation.
5. How should a dough sheeter machine be maintained?
Regular cleaning, proper lubrication of moving parts, and periodic inspection help keep the dough sheeter machine functioning smoothly.
6. How should bakeries decide between manual and automatic dough sheeters?
The choice depends on production volume, labour availability, and whether the bakery prioritizes speed or hands-on control.
